This high-visibility yellow acrylic balaclava by Superior Glove is designed to keep the head, face and neck warm while wearing a construction or safety helmet. One size, made of soft, stretchy 100% acrylic, it fits under most helmets and delivers warmth and comfort on cold days. Its bright yellow colour makes the wearer noticeable in traffic areas, a real asset for outdoor winter work.
Made of 100% acrylic, the balaclava combines warmth, lightness and comfort. Its soft, stretchy fabric hugs the head for full coverage of the face and neck without interfering with the helmet.
The bright yellow colour improves how well the worker is seen in traffic areas or low light, unlike darker shades that are harder to spot. This colour choice adds a valuable safety factor for work near vehicles, forklifts or heavy equipment. Note, however, that the balaclava alone does not replace a certified high-visibility garment of a higher class.
Ideal for outdoor work, it fits under the safety helmet to insulate the head, face and neck from the cold. It suits construction sites, mining, utilities and flaggers who benefit from its bright colour.
Avoid hot water, which could damage the acrylic fibres. Wash by hand or machine in cold water with a mild detergent, then tumble dry on low. Acrylic does not need ironing.
